INFINITI Chairman and global president Roland Krueger today announced INFINITI would host the fourth version of its startup LAB in Hong Kong to develop startups. Krueger made the announcement at the RISE web summit event today, where he was a keynote speaker.
“Hong Kong is a very entrepreneurial city and RISE is filled with entrepreneurs, so what better place to announce a new initiative to nurture startups to support a digital ecosystem, and retail and mobility services than here at RISE. INFINITI and our partners NEST will be taking applications soon for our fourth startup LAB in Hong Kong, which will focus on premium mobility services. Helping startups pursue their dreams is always inspiring and it helps all of us at INFINITI to think and act more like a startup.“ – Roland Krueger, Chairman and Global President, INFINITI Motor Company, Ltd.
INFINITI will host its fourth LAB in Hong Kong this fall with a theme of “premium connected mobility.” INFINITI LAB 4.0 will help nurture startups to support a digital ecosystem, and retail and mobility services. INFINITI LAB is a global accelerator that helps entrepreneurs achieve success. Its programs give startups expert mentoring and access to an unrivalled network of partners and investors. INFINITI LAB offers four unique programs, run in locations around the world, to support startups at any stage on their path to success. INFINITI has conducted six LABs globally.
